Co-constructive tool
concept on co-constructive tool
co-constructive tools are sophisticated digital platforms designed to enhance collaborative learning and knowledge building. These tools leverage the capabilities of ICT to create interactive environments where students can work together in real-time, sharing resources and ideas seamlessly across digital spaces. By integrating features such as shared documents and mind mapping applications, co-constructive tools facilitate the joint creation and refinement of knowledge artifacts. It has special features where one can edit other works and can update the information if necessary. There are several advantages of using this tool as students can work on an assignment simultaneously, making it easy to collaborate without the need for multiple versions and constant messaging back and forth. Moreover, features such as comment, chat and suggested edits facilitates immediate communication among team members, improving the quality and speed of collaborative efforts. lastly, the ability to work simultaneously and see changes in real time significantly reduces the time needed to finalize assignments or documents, enhancing productivity and meeting deadlines more effectively. Thus, as a teacher we can use such tools with students to make the learning environment more effective, meaningful and engaging.
